谷歌首席决策科学家:AI难免犯错,唯有人类可以悬崖勒马

  Cassie Kozyrkov在过去五年里在谷歌担任过各种各样的技术职务,但她现在担任着“首席决策科学家”这个有点奇怪的职位。“决策科学是数据和行为科学的交叉学科,涉及统计学、机器学习、心理学、经济学等。

  实际上,这意味着Kozyrkov帮助谷歌推动了一个积极的人工智能议程——或者,至少,让人们相信人工智能并不像许多人宣称的那么糟糕。

  焦虑

  “机器人正在偷走我们的工作”,“人工智能是人类生存的最大威胁”,类似的言论已不绝如耳,尤其在过去几年里,这种担忧变得更加明显。

  人工智能对话助手渗入我们的家中,汽车和卡车自动驾驶似乎指日可待,机器可以在电脑游戏中打败人类,甚至创意艺术也不能幸免于人工智能的冲击。另一方面,我们也被告知枯燥重复的工作可能会成为过去。

  人们对自己在自动化世界中的未来感到焦虑和困惑,这是可以理解的。但是,根据Kozyrkov的说法,人工智能只是人类努力方向的延伸。

  “人类的故事就是自动化的故事,” Kozyrkov表示。“人类的史诗就是要把事情做得更好——从有人拿起一块石头砸向另一块石头的那一刻起,因为事情可以做得更快。我们是一个制造工具的物种,我们反抗苦差事。”

  对人工智能潜在恐惧的原因是我们觉得它可以做得比人类更好,但这种担心并不成立。Kozyrkov认为,所有工具都比人类好。理发师用剪刀理发,因为用手把头发剪出来是一种不太理想的体验。印刷机使文本的大规模生产成为可能,其规模是人类用钢笔无法复制的。但笔本身就开启了一个充满机遇的世界。

  “我们所有的工具都比人类好——这就是工具的意义所在,” Kozyrkov继续说道。“如果没有工具你可以做得更好,为什么要使用工具呢?如果你担心电脑的认知能力比你强,那我要提醒你,你的笔和纸在记忆方面比你强。我的水桶比我更擅长装水,我的计算器比我更擅长把六位数相乘。人工智能在某些方面也会变是如此。”

  当然,许多人对人工智能和自动化的潜在恐惧并不是说它会比人类更擅长做事。对许多人来说,真正的危险在于,任何恶意实体可以肆无忌惮地对我们的一举一动进行跟踪和微观管理,从而在我们身上投下反乌托邦的阴影——几乎不费任何力气就能实现一个秘密的宏伟愿景。

  其他的担忧与算法偏见、缺乏足够的监督以及最终的末日场景有关:如果某件事发生了严重且无意的错误,该怎么办?

  偏见

  研究人员已经证明了人脸识别系统中固有的偏见,比如亚马逊的Rekognition。民主党总统候选人参议员Elizabeth Warren此前呼吁联邦机构解决算法偏见的问题,比如美联储如何处理货币贷款歧视。

  但人们对人工智能如何真正减少人类现有偏见的关注少之又少。

  旧金山最近宣称,它将使用人工智能来减少对犯罪嫌疑人的偏见,例如,自动修改警方报告中的某些信息。

  在招聘领域,风投支持的Fetcher正着手帮助企业利用人工智能寻找人才。该公司声称,人工智能还有助于将人类偏见降到最低。Fetcher通过在线渠道自动寻找潜在候选人,并使用关键字来确定个人可能拥有的技能,而这些技能并没有列在个人资料中。该公司将其平台宣传为消除招聘偏见的一种简单方法,因为如果你训练一个系统遵循一套严格的标准,只关注技能和经验,性别、种族或年龄等因素将不会被考虑在内。

  Fetcher联合创始人兼首席执行官Andres Blank表示:“我们相信,我们可以利用技术来解决多种形式的招聘偏见,帮助公司建立更加多样化和包容性的组织。”

  但对人工智能系统性歧视的担忧,是许多人工智能领域的首要议题。微软敦促美国政府监管面部识别系统,研究人员正致力于在不影响预测结果准确性的前提下,减少人工智能中的偏见。

  人为因素

  最重要的是,人工智能还处于相对起步阶段,我们仍在研究如何解决算法偏见等问题。但Kozyrkov表示,人工智能所显示的偏见与现有的人类偏见是一样的——用于训练机器的数据集与用于教育人类的教科书完全一样。

  “数据集和教科书都有人类作者——它们都是根据人类的指令收集的,”她说。“如果你给你的学生一本由一位怀有严重偏见的作者编写的教科书,你认为你的学生不会染上同样的偏见吗?”

  当然,在现实世界中,受人尊敬的同行评审的期刊或教科书应该有足够的监督来对抗任何明显的偏见——但如果作者、他们的数据源以及鼓励学生阅读教科书的老师都有同样的偏见呢?任何陷阱可能要到很久以后才会被发现,到那时想要阻止任何不良影响就太晚了。

  因此,Kozyrkov夫认为,“视角的多样性”对于确保偏见最小化是必不可少的。

  她说:“你对数据的关注越多,你就越有可能发现那些潜在的不良案例。所以在人工智能中,多样性是必须拥有的。你确实需要从不同的角度来看待和思考如何使用这些例子来影响世界。”

  郑州男科医院:https://myyk.familydoctor.com.cn/12248/郑州男科医院哪家好:https://myyk.familydoctor.com.cn/12248/郑州割包皮手术多少钱:https://myyk.familydoctor.com.cn/12248/

原文地址:https://www.cnblogs.com/sushine1/p/11039834.html

时间: 2025-01-07 06:46:27

谷歌首席决策科学家:AI难免犯错,唯有人类可以悬崖勒马的相关文章

哪些要素在做产品需求的时候容易犯错?

产品经理是一个思考的工种,而多想多思考成为产品经理成长最为关键点.而经验会帮助产品经理在产品需求认知和产品设计上不会犯错误,而快速进入角色.很多新手却办不到这一点. 一.判别需求是否真实存在?需求真伪性 当产品经理接到一个业务部门的需求,一个老板的需求.很多人惯性的思维是如何完成这个需求.而展开对需求思考.但是在此之前,我们需要去判别这个需求的真伪性.如果是伪需求,那么做出来是对我们的产品没有任何的意义.需求是否真实存在,真实性如何?是否有场景可以承接这个需求本身. 二.表面需求后,没有去了解更

javascript sort方法容易犯错的地方

sort方法用来对数组排序非常方便.但是sort(func)这个func参数的构造却很容易混淆. 这个func的作用是,把排序结果里任意相邻两项a,b放入到func里来执行,如果返回值都为-1,则为正序排列,如返回值都为1,则为逆序排列. 例如,[1,3,65,97,45,6,2] 如果要正序,就应该写成[1,3,65,97,45,6,2].sort(function(a, b){return a - b;}), 如果要逆序:[1,3,65,97,45,6,2].sort(function(a,

致DBA:为什么你经常犯错,是因为你做的功课不够

专职做DBA已经6年多的事件了,看同行.同事犯了太多的错误,自己也犯了非常多的错误.一路走来,感触非常深.然而绝大多数的错误其实都是很低级的错误.有的是因为不了解某个引擎的特性导致:有的是因为对线上环境不了解导致:有的是因为经验不足导致:一路上,跌跌撞撞,从小公司DBA,到腾讯高级DBA,再到现在的金融数据库DBA. 不由得想起5年前的我,刚进入DBA行业,缺乏经验,经常犯错误,不是我不够努力,更多的是初来咋到的我根本不知道应该在哪方面下功夫.本文就是基于这方面的考虑,根据自己在DBA这个职业上

作用域--高手都容易犯错的地方

在js中,我们都知道,this的指向是由它被调用时的上下文所决定的.例如: window.id = 888; var data = { id : 999, getId : function(){ console.log(this.id) } } data.getId(); // 999; var getId = data.getId; getId(); // 888 当我们在data上调用getId方法时,this显然是指向data对象的.这个很好理解,我们需要注意的是,当我们把data上的ge

Makefileeasy犯错的语法

1.引言 近期学习android的Build系统,接触最多的自然就是Makefile语法.发现非常多easy出错的地方,不避开这些错误语法没法真正了解Makefile的内涵.以下就介绍遇到的一些让人困惑的语法错误 2.列举easy犯错的地方 ifeq条件推断 ifeq($(fro),no) endif 多么简单的语法.可是运行会报错例如以下: Makefile:2: *** missing separator. Stop. 原因: ifeq和左括号'('之间是必须有空格的. shell脚本的使用

应试教育的死穴,恰在于堵死了孩子“犯错”的空间

今天周日,闲着没事,来公司梳理一下最近的项目心得,又翻起了前段时间看到的文章<应试教育的死穴,恰在于堵死了孩子"犯错"的空间>,来浅谈一下自己的感受吧! 还是从自身谈起,小时候手笨,脑子不是很灵活,于是会出现各种的问题,这时候老师就开始发火.生气,轻则骂几句,重则棍棒伺候.于是在这种环境下,总是害怕犯错事,害怕犯错误. 还有一种情景,就是所谓的考试了,尤其是语文考试,相比大家都经历过,对于一篇阅读理解的分析,每个人都有自己的见解,写写自己的心理体会不就得了,可总是会有一种所

JAVA 犯错汇总

ResultSet-->next() //伪代码 ResultSet rs = null; rs1 = stmt.executeQuery(); //if(!rs.next()){ //这里就是坑我代码 // return false; //} while(rs.next()) { //rs.next()这个方法坑了我,让我总是得不到第一条数据 执行一次,往下走一回,我靠,不带这么坑的 } JAVA 犯错汇总

[C/C++]_[初级]_[编程容易犯错的地方]

场景: 1. 这里总结一些日常的容易犯错的细节. 问题1:一个类A有成员变量int deleted,给定一个A的对象指针 *a, 判断deleted为真的时候输出一个语句. 一般情况下新手会这样写: if(a) { if(a->deleted) { cout << "deleted" << endl; } } 但这样其实不够精简和浪费行数, 应该这样. if(a && a->deleted) { cout << "

勇于犯错才能更好的成长

朋友,假如你希望你一生都不犯错误,假设你真如愿以偿,那我会告诉你:你生最大的错误就是你没有任何过错. 意大利的朗根尼西说过:“不要给我忠告,让我自己去犯错误.”这似乎只是一句妙语,事实上含有很深刻的意义.一个人怕犯错,就是畏惧现实,一个人想逃避犯错,就是逃避现实,他永远不会在生活中独立,自强.不要简单地否认它,想一想,试一试,你就会理解朗根尼西的话. 过错在一定意义上并不是坏事.任何事物都具有其二重性,有好的一面也有坏的一面.过错也不例外.它虽然会给你带来一些损失,但要知道,一个人如果没有相对的